Here are the top five innovative Breeding Building Materials that every eco-conscious homeowner should consider:

  1. Recycled Steel

    • Advantages: Durable, abundant, and requires less energy to produce than new steel.
    • Disadvantages: Can be more expensive upfront, and may need additional insulation to meet energy standards.
  2. Bamboo

    • Advantages: Highly renewable, lightweight, and stronger than many traditional woods.
    • Disadvantages: Vulnerable to moisture and insect damage, requiring proper maintenance.
  3. Hempcrete

    • Advantages: Excellent insulation properties, carbon-negative, and non-toxic.
    • Disadvantages: Not load-bearing, requiring a structural frame, and can be more labor-intensive to install.
  4. Reclaimed Wood

    • Advantages: Unique aesthetic appeal and reduces demand for new lumber, preserving forests.
    • Disadvantages: Potential for hidden defects and requires treatment to ensure it meets modern building codes.
  5. Mycelium (Mushroom Material)

    • Advantages: Composed of organic materials, biodegradable, and has excellent insulation properties.
    • Disadvantages: Relatively new to the market, requiring more research and development for wider applications.

When considering Breeding Building Materials, it’s essential to weigh the pros and cons carefully. For instance, while recycled steel showcases great durability, it can also involve a more significant initial investment compared to traditional materials. Conversely, bamboo stands out for its rapid renewability but does require diligent maintenance to prevent damage.
